We foster a culture of love for God and love for others, trust and teamwork, and a collaborative environment in which we get to do our best work every day.The Communications Manager oversees Sight & Sound's internal and external communication efforts. They collaborate on the strategy, development, and execution of all marketing communications, ensuring messaging is clear, consistent, and in alignment with the mission, values, and culture for all branches of Sight & Sound.Essential Duties and Responsibilities Partner with the Senior Marketing Manager to develop the communication and content strategy that supports company direction, brand positioning, product launches, and public relations.Identify the voice, cadence, and placement of communications for all Sight & Sound branches. Ensure communications are written in one voice and convey a consistent message aligned with mission and brand standards.Partner with the Digital Marketing Team and Brand Creative team to oversee the messaging and content for social media and email marketing as well as the social media moderation schedule.Lead and provide professional development for communications teams.Lead public relations efforts for all branches of Sight & Sound Ministries, supporting shows, films, and special events, including oversight of social media influencer campaigns. Responsible for reporting and sharing coverage and campaign results.Manage corporate and marketing events as well as trade show, consumer show and community involvement needs. Guide execution efforts, ensuring consistent brand presence.Lead corporate communications by proactively meeting with key department managers and leadership to stay current on happenings and foresee activities that have companywide impact. Support teams by curating information that increases employee awareness.Oversee internal communication tools including Center Stage, Company Meetings, and Communication Boards, ensuring relevant content is shared in a clear and timely manner.All other duties as assigned.Prerequisites Excellent communicator with strong speaking, writing, and editing skillsMust be a team player and love people; ability to communicate effectively with people at all levels of the organizationExperience managing multiple projects, teams, and deadlines simultaneously in a fast-paced and complex environmentStrong organizational and planning skills, high attention to detailAbility to think innovatively and creatively, and change course if necessary, to achieve desired resultsSelf-motivated with a positive and professional approachSome travel may be requiredThe physical demands of this position are typical for a desk job.
